Door Planing in Kansas City, KS
Door planing services involve carefully shaving or adjusting the thickness of existing doors to ensure a proper fit within doorframes. This process is often used to correct issues such as doors that stick, do not close properly, or have become uneven over time. Projects may include trimming interior or exterior doors, adjusting closet doors, or refining entryway doors to improve functionality and appearance. Homeowners typically seek door planing when they notice difficulty opening or closing doors, or when preparing doors for new hardware installation.
Before requesting door planing services, property owners should consider the current condition of the doors and frames, including any warping, swelling, or damage that might affect the planing process. It is helpful to understand the specific adjustments needed, whether for clearance, alignment, or aesthetic reasons. Clear measurements and details about the door’s condition can assist in achieving the desired outcome, ensuring the door fits properly and operates smoothly within its frame.

Door Planing Questions
What is door planing? Door planing involves shaving or trimming a door to adjust its height, width, or fit within a frame for proper operation.
When should door planing be needed? It is typically needed when a door sticks, rubs against the floor or frame, or does not close properly.
What types of doors can be planed? Both interior and exterior doors made from wood or similar materials can be planed to improve fit and function.
How does door planing improve door performance? It ensures the door opens and closes smoothly, reduces gaps, and helps prevent drafts or damage.
